This poster is to help remind students what they need to do when they forgot what they should be doing on an assignment. I made this when I started doing centers and each time a student came and asked me a question about the assignment that was covered in the instructions, I would point to the sign. Within a couple of days, the number of times I was asked what they should be doing dropped dramatically. It was amazing and nice. I'm now able to work with students during centers time.
This chart reminds students to first read directions, second to quietly ask a classmate, third to quietly ask another classmate, and last ask the teacher.
